Events and Office Manager

Our client, an economic development agency located in Boston, is seeking an Events and Office Manager. This is a temporary opportunity and can compensate up to $32/hr. depending on experience. Qualified candidates are encouraged to apply today for immediate consideration!Job Duties Responsible for the logistics of public events and/or participates in locally, regionally, nationally, and internationally.Responsible for logistics and planning of internal staff events. Supervise event logistics including managing supplies and collateral, planning event speaking programs and agendas, conducting speaker outreach, and providing onsite support to staff, event speakers, and attendees.Periodically travel to event venues across the state to evaluate sites and locations (no car required).Collaborate with the Legal team on the management and execution of contracts.Manage the invoicing relating to external service providers.Responsible for managing organization-wide catering orders with the goal of keeping costs low.Coordinate daily operational needs for the main office and facilitate operational needs.Conduct regular inventory and oversee ordering of office supplies and other materials to ensure an adequate number of supplies are always in stock. Store office supplies neatly and keep supply areas organized and free of clutter.Resolve operational issues quickly.Manage the process for allowing outside entities use of the office space. Coordinate the Board meeting preparation process and day-of logistics.Be in person to meet with vendors and building staff.Serve as point person to coordinate and execute event set-up and tear-down, with the aim of executing all logistical aspects seamlessly.Manage staff meetings such as the All-Staff meetings, preparing presentations and agendas and day-of logistics.Develop and manage a plan to ensure kitchen is clean and organized. Work out of the Boston office, at minimum, one day a week to monitor office needs.Other duties as assigned by the Chief of Staff or CEO.QualificationsExcellent interpersonal and communication skills.Excellent project management, problem-resolution, and negotiation skills.Excellent PC skills and ability to use related business applications e.g., Excel, PowerPoint, Word, Access, databases, E-mail, and Internet.High level of professionalism with good comprehension skills.Understanding of or aptitude for learning about clean energy preferred.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ively in a team environment. Demonstrated 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ities effectively. Demonstrated ability to meet tight deadlines.Demonstrated ability to write and edit documents.
